Israeli occupation warplanes Sunday night attacked agricultural land in the besieged Gaza Strip, according to local sources.
They said that the Israeli occupation warplanes targets empty agricultural land east of Al-Zaytoon neighborhood, east of the Gaza Strip.

Fortunately, no injures reported.
Hebrew media claimed that a missile was fired from Gaza toward an illegal Israeli open land near the Gaza border.
Last week on Friday, the Israeli occupation warplanes attacked several posts belonging to the Palestinian resistance.

Home to 1.9 million people, Gaza is 41km (25 miles) long and 10km wide, an enclave besieged by Israel for more than 13 years.
The Gaza Strip was devastated by 3 wars by the Israeli occupation, left more than 3000 Palestinians, mostly civilians dead.
Thousands of homes in Gaza were destroyed during the wars. The result has been Gazans seeking to house their families in whatever way they can, with some 18,000 homes either destroyed or severely damaged during the last 50-day war in 2014.
